Enhanced Support for 988 Crisis Lifeline and Mental Health Centers

This act increases funding and expands the capabilities of the national 988 mental health crisis lifeline and local support centers. The goal is to provide faster and easier access to help for individuals in need, including free calls from pre-paid phones and improved outreach to at-risk groups.
Key points
Increased funding for the 988 lifeline to $50 million annually for fiscal years 2022-2026, providing more resources for assistance.
Calls to 988 and the National Suicide Prevention Lifeline from pre-paid phones will be free and will not deduct minutes.
All 988 calls will be routed to local crisis centers, ensuring help is available close to home.
The act mandates data collection on disparities in access to help, aiming to better support diverse communities.
